6.    Air India Flight Crash 171


Google Metrics – 100 K + searches 
Terms - air india flight 171 crash, air india flight crash pilot, air india flight crash
 


The mystery of what happened to the fuel-control switches on the doomed Air India Flight 171 has become the central puzzle of one of India’s worst aviation disasters in decades.

Investigators discovered that the fuel-control switches, which regulate fuel supply to the engines, had moved from the ‘Run’ to the ‘Cutoff’ position within seconds of each other—a catastrophic move that cut off fuel flow and triggered the dual-engine failure.

8.    Josaa Round 6 seat allotment results 


Google Metrics – 100 K + searches 
Terms - josaa round 6 seat allotment result, josaa, josaa counselling 2025, josaa counselling
 


The JoSAA Round 6 seat allotment result for 2025 was released on July 16, 2025, marking the final round of counselling for admissions into IITs and the last round for the NIT+ system. Candidates who participated in Round 6 can check their seat allotment by logging into the official JoSAA portal using their JEE Main application number and password. This round finalizes seat allocation for IIT aspirants, while leftover seats in NITs, IIITs, and GFTIs proceed to CSAB counselling.


9.    Shubhanshu Shukla 


Google Metrics – 100 K + searches , 10800 tweets with #ShubhanshuShukla
Terms - shubhanshu shukla, subhanshu shukla, indian astronaut shubhanshu shukla, captain shubhanshu Shukla
 


Launched on June 25, 2025, and returning safely on July 15, 2025, Shukla’s 18-day mission not only reignited national pride but also represented a major leap for India’s human spaceflight ambitions under ISRO’s Gaganyaan programme.

A distinguished Indian Air Force test pilot, Shukla conducted over 60 experiments during his time in microgravity, focusing on muscle regeneration, algal and microbial growth, crop viability, and cognitive performance in space—research that will critically inform India’s future space endeavors.

14.    Mitchell Starc


Google Metrics – 100 K + searches , 2444 tweets with #MitchellStarc
Terms - mitchell starc, aus vs wi, west indies cricket team, lowest test score
 


Mitchell Starc’s devastating bowling spearheaded Australia’s dominance over West Indies in the recent Test series, with his fiery opening spell triggering the Windies’ historic collapse to just 27 runs in their second innings at Sabina Park—the second-lowest innings total in Test cricket history and the lowest for West Indies at home.

This match record highlights the sharp contrast between a top-ranked Australian side, led by Starc's lethal accuracy and swing with the pink ball, and a struggling West Indies team that has faced steep decline despite sporadic flashes of brilliance in recent years.

16.    Dustin Poirier 


Google Metrics – 50 K + searches 
Terms - dustin poirier, ufc 318, ufc, max Holloway, 106000 tweets with #Dustin
 


Dustin Poirier’s storied 16-year UFC career took its final bow at UFC 318 in New Orleans, as he faced familiar rival Max Holloway in an emotional trilogy fight. The main event delivered drama right until the last 15 seconds, with both fighters standing toe-to-toe and trading heavy shots. Holloway, who’d been knocked down in their earlier encounters, turned the tide early by flooring Poirier in the first round and outlanding him with 113 significant head strikes to Poirier’s 99.

Even as fatigue set in for Poirier late in the fight, he showed heart and resilience that drew respect from UFC fans worldwide.

3.    Tesla India


Google Metrics – 200 K + searches 
Terms - tesla india, tesla, tesla model y, tesla car price
Twitter Metrics – 1690000 tweets with #Tesla 
 


Tesla’s arrival in India felt nothing short of seismic. The electric pioneer didn’t just put a foot on Indian soil—it rolled in with the Model Y, priced at a hefty ₹59.89 lakh ex-showroom, a sum that echoes both prestige and the steep import tariffs that CEO Elon Musk has openly lamented. On July 15, 2025, Tesla unfurled its first Indian showroom in Mumbai, setting a new stage for luxury electric SUVs amidst a market where EVs still bustle at just 4% of total sales.

The Model Y—offered in rear-wheel drive and a long-range rear-wheel drive variant—brings futuristic style married to serious range.

5.    HDFC Bank share 


Google Metrics – 100 K + searches 
Terms - hdfc bank share price, hdfc share price, hdfc bank bonus issue, hdfc bank share
 


HDFC Bank’s share price on July 21, 2025, is riding a wave of cautious optimism, trading near ₹2,000 after a solid Q1 performance that sparked fresh investor interest. The bank’s 12% profit jump to ₹18,155 crore signals strong growth, but a slight dip in net interest margin to 3.35% whispers caution about rising costs weighing on margins. This nuanced performance is reflected in the share price gyrations as traders balance upbeat earnings with near-term margin pressures.
